Frequently asked questions

Is Santiago cheaper than West Palm Beach?

Yes. Santiago has a cost of living index of 62 vs 117 for West Palm Beach (100 = US average). That's about 47% cheaper.

How much will I save moving from West Palm Beach to Santiago?

On a $75K salary, moving from West Palm Beach to Santiago saves roughly $1,600/month on core expenses. That's ~$19,200/year.

What salary do I need in Santiago to match my West Palm Beach lifestyle?

To maintain the same purchasing power as $75,000 in West Palm Beach, you'd need roughly $39,744/year in Santiago. This is based on the overall COL index difference.
